The following terms apply to Tencent Cloud Object Storage (COS) Underwriting Resource Packages (the Underwriting Resource Package).
1. General Rules
The Parties mutually understand and acknowledge that, in order to fully realize the value of resources, maximize benefits, and safeguard the achievement of their respective commercial objectives, both you and Tencent Cloud, having each conducted a prudent assessment, have agreed through mutual consultation to cooperate under the Underwriting Mode for the relevant products under these Terms:
1.1 Underwriting Mode means: from the date on which you place an order for an Underwriting Resource Package on Tencent Cloud's official website, the Underwriting Resource Package shall take effect in accordance with the selected Effective Region, Underwriting Specification, Underwriting Quantity and Underwriting Duration; it shall automatically continue in effect prior to the expiry of the Underwriting Duration and cannot be actively deleted, unsubscribed, or terminated by you. During the Underwriting Duration, Tencent Cloud shall bill and deduct fees from your account in accordance with Clause 3.2 (Deduction Method) of these Special Terms, and you shall ensure that its account holds sufficient funds to enable the deduction to be completed normally. Whether you actually generate storage usage during the Underwriting Duration, or whether any usage interruption occurs (including without limitation your business adjustments or third-party causes), shall not affect the effectiveness and fee deduction of the Underwriting Resource Package. Force majeure events shall be handled in accordance with Clause 5.3 (Force Majeure) of these Terms.
1.2 If your account falls into arrears, resulting in Tencent Cloud being unable to complete the fee deduction during the Underwriting Duration in accordance with the Deduction Method under Clause 3.2, you shall pay compensation to Tencent Cloud in accordance with the provisions of Clause 4 (Underwriting Compensation Rules) of these Special Terms.
1.3 On the premise that you use the Underwriting Resource Package in accordance with the Underwriting Duration, Underwriting Specification and Underwriting Quantity, Tencent Cloud shall grant you a price discount for the settlement of the Underwriting Resource Package (i.e., the Underwriting Discount Unit Price).
1.4 Once you place an order for an Underwriting Resource Package under these Terms, during the Underwriting Duration, the Underwriting Resource Package does not support price reduction, specification changes (upgrade or downgrade), unsubscription, renewal, or auto-renewal; meanwhile, you shall ensure that its account holds sufficient funds during the underwriting period to enable daily/monthly fee deductions.
1.5 After your account falls into arrears, the COS service and the fee deduction for the Underwriting Resource Package shall be implemented in accordance with Tencent Cloud's 《COS Payment Overdue》. To avoid ambiguity, during the data retention period after service suspension due to arrears (default: 15 calendar days), the Underwriting Resource Package shall continue to be billed at the selected Underwriting Specification and Underwriting Quantity, generating amounts due for deduction. If you top up its account and restore service within the data retention period, the aforementioned amounts due for deduction shall be paid in arrears. 1.6 Prior to the expiry of the Underwriting Duration, if you elect to increase the Underwriting Specification, Underwriting Quantity and/or extend the Underwriting Duration, the Parties shall reach mutual agreement and execute separate terms accordingly.
1.7 Upon expiry of the Underwriting Duration, if you elect to continue using the Underwriting Resource Package, you shall notify Tencent Cloud one month in advance, and the Parties shall execute separate terms for the new underwriting cooperation and re-purchase the same; otherwise, the relevant discount for the Underwriting Resource Package shall automatically lapse upon expiry, and the Parties shall settle at Tencent Cloud's list price prevailing at the time of underwriting expiry.
(For the purposes of these Special Terms, "purchase" or "place an order" means: after you enter into these Terms, you configure the specific product and place an order through the Tencent Cloud website or the corresponding interface of Tencent Cloud.)
1.8 Definitions:
(1) Underwriting Specification: means the combination of the storage type and the Underwriting Resource Package specification selected by you when placing an order on Tencent Cloud's official website.
Storage types include: Underwriting Standard Storage Capacity, Underwriting Standard Storage (Multi-AZ) Capacity, Underwriting Infrequent Access Storage Capacity, Underwriting Infrequent Access Storage (Multi-AZ) Capacity, Underwriting Archive Storage Capacity, Underwriting Archive Storage (Multi-AZ) Capacity, Underwriting Deep Archive Storage Capacity;
Underwriting Resource Package specifications include: 500TB, 1PB, 2PB, 5PB, 10PB, 20PB, 30PB, 50PB, 100PB.
For example: "Underwriting Standard Storage Capacity 500TB" corresponds to "COS Underwriting Standard Storage Capacity Package 512,000GB".
(2) Underwriting Duration: means the purchase duration selected by you when placing an order on Tencent Cloud's official website, i.e., the validity period of the Underwriting Resource Package, including: 1 month, 3 months, 6 months, 1 year, 2 years, 3 years, 4 years, 5 years, and 6 years.
(3) Underwriting Quantity: means the number of Underwriting Resource Packages ordered by you. Under the same order or different orders, you may order multiple Underwriting Resource Packages of the same or different Underwriting Specifications, and the number thereof constitutes the Underwriting Quantity referred to in this Clause.
(4) Underwriting Volume: means the aggregate specification obtained by summing all Underwriting Resource Packages ordered by you by storage type, i.e., "for each storage type, Underwriting Specification × Underwriting Quantity". Different storage types are not cumulative and are calculated in parallel by type.
(5) Underwriting Discount Unit Price: means the discounted unit price granted by Tencent Cloud based on the storage type selected by you at the time of ordering. Such unit price shall be as recorded in your order, and, from the date of ordering, shall be locked for the duration of the Underwriting Duration and shall not vary with any adjustment (increase or decrease) to the list price on Tencent Cloud's official website.
(6) Effective Region: means the region scope in which the Underwriting Resource Package takes effect and is deducted, as selected by you when placing an order on Tencent Cloud's official website, i.e., the scope described in Clause 3.7 (Scope of Application) of these Terms, including: Chinese Mainland General (including Shanghai Autonomous Driving Cloud Zone, available on whitelist basis), and Hong Kong, China and Overseas General; Financial Cloud regions are not supported.
The specific values, scope and corresponding amounts of the Underwriting Specification, Underwriting Quantity, Underwriting Duration, Underwriting Volume, Underwriting Discount Unit Price and Effective Region shall be subject to the order actually placed by you on the official website page referred to in Clause 2; once an order is generated, the foregoing elements shall be locked and remain unchanged during the Underwriting Duration.
To avoid ambiguity, the Effective Region, Underwriting Specification, Underwriting Quantity and Underwriting Duration of the Underwriting Resource Package under the Underwriting Mode agreed in these Terms shall be subject to the actual order placed by you on Tencent Cloud's official website (refer to the "COS Underwriting Resource Package" page under the Self-Purchased Resource Packages module in the Resource Package Management category of the COS Console). The product form, specification definition, billing rules and deduction logic of the Underwriting Resource Package shall be subject to the 《COS Underwriting Resource Package Overview》. Notes:
1. If the Underwriting Duration exceeds the validity period of these Terms, the validity period of these Terms shall be automatically extended until the expiry of the specific Underwriting Duration.
2. The following exceptions apply to the discounts:
(1) Under no circumstances may vouchers be used, nor shall full-amount-return discounts apply, in respect of an Underwriting Resource Package purchased under the underwriting mode during the Underwriting Duration;
(2) Under no circumstances shall the deduction amount of the Underwriting Resource Package include any amounts that do not require actual payment by you, such as gifts, vouchers, or full-amount-return amounts.
3. Underwriting Volume Rules
The Parties mutually understand and acknowledge that the use of Underwriting Resource Packages shall comply with the following rules:
3.1 Deduction Scope: Underwriting Resource Packages may only be used to deduct storage capacity fees for the corresponding Effective Region and corresponding storage type; cross-region deduction is not supported, cross-storage-type deduction is not supported, and deduction of request fees, traffic fees, data retrieval fees, management feature fees and other fees is not supported;
3.2 Deduction Method: During the Underwriting Duration, deductions shall be made on a daily average basis, with the usage quota reset daily; the specific billing cadence depends on your account settlement method (post-paid daily-settled accounts are billed daily; post-paid monthly-settled accounts are billed monthly), and the deduction rules shall be governed by the 《COS Underwriting Resource Package Overview》; 3.3 Minimum Deduction Floor: For a given storage type, if your daily average storage volume for that type is less than or equal to the Underwriting Volume for that type, the fee shall be deducted in full based on the Underwriting Volume for that type; any portion exceeding the Underwriting Volume for that type shall be charged on a pay-as-you-go basis. In other words, the Underwriting Volume for each storage type constitutes the minimum baseline for your daily fee deduction during the Underwriting Duration;
3.4 Deduction Priority: The system shall settle in the following order of priority: Underwriting Resource Package > Free Tier > Resource Package > Pay-As-You-Go;
3.5 Non-Cumulative Quota: Any unused quota within a billing cycle shall not be carried over to the next cycle;
3.6 Stacking: Underwriting Resource Packages support stacking. If multiple Underwriting Resource Packages are purchased at one time, their specifications are stacked, but their validity periods (purchase durations) are not stacked.
3.7 Scope of Application: Underwriting Resource Packages support Chinese Mainland General (including Shanghai Autonomous Driving Cloud Zone, available on whitelist basis), and Hong Kong, China and Overseas General regions; Financial Cloud regions are not supported (i.e., the scope described in Clause 1.8(6) (Effective Region) of these Terms);
3.8 Independence of Usage and Billing: Once an order is placed for an Underwriting Resource Package, fees shall be automatically deducted in accordance with the Deduction Method under Clause 3.2; whether you actually generate storage usage during the Underwriting Duration, or whether any brief or prolonged usage interruption occurs (including without limitation your business adjustments or third-party causes), shall not affect the automatic fee deduction of the Underwriting Resource Package at the specified rate, nor shall it constitute a reduction or exemption of your underwriting obligations. Service availability liability arising from Tencent Cloud's faults shall be handled separately in accordance with the 《Cloud Object Storage Service Level Agreement (SLA)》 and shall not affect the fee deductions agreed in these Terms; force majeure events shall be handled in accordance with Clause 5.3 (Force Majeure) of these Terms. 4. Underwriting Compensation Rules
4.1 The Parties, having agreed through mutual consultation, hereby confirm that the Underwriting Resource Package adopts a post-paid settlement method, with the Underwriting Volume of each storage type serving as the minimum deduction baseline. Under normal circumstances, Tencent Cloud shall continuously bill and deduct fees from your account in accordance with the Deduction Method under Clause 3.2 and the Minimum Deduction Floor under Clause 3.3.
4.2 Where your account is in arrears and, during the data retention period after service suspension due to arrears (default: 15 calendar days) in accordance with Tencent Cloud's 《COS Payment Overdue》, the Underwriting Resource Package shall continue to be billed and generate amounts due for deduction in accordance with the Minimum Deduction Floor under Clause 3.3; the settlement method shall be as follows: (1) If you top up its account and restore service within the data retention period, the amounts due for deduction incurred during the service suspension period shall be paid in arrears;
(2) If you fail to top up within the data retention period, resulting in data destruction and service termination, you shall pay compensation to Tencent Cloud for the portion of the remaining Underwriting Duration for which fee deduction could not be completed. The compensation shall be calculated as follows:
Payable Compensation = Σ (Underwriting Volume of each storage type × Number of Days for Which Deduction Was Due but Not Made for that storage type × Corresponding Underwriting Discount Unit Price)
(i.e., calculated separately for each storage type based on its Underwriting Volume, the number of days for which deduction was due but not made, and the Underwriting Discount Unit Price for each storage type, then summed.)
4.3 If the circumstances described in Clause 4.2 occur, you shall pay the aforementioned arrears or compensation amount to Tencent Cloud within 30 days from the date of Tencent Cloud's request; any other routine outstanding fees owed by you to Tencent Cloud during the arrears or compensation period (such as actual usage incurred, other product fees, etc.) shall not be exempted by reason of the payment of such arrears or compensation.
4.4 You undertake and acknowledge that the calculation method for the compensation rules set forth above is the result of the Parties' full assessment, taking into account the particularity of the transaction under these Terms, and fully reflects the Parties' respective commercial interests and their respective considerations of profit and loss. you have, at the time of signing these Terms, fully assessed the underwriting requirements and the underwriting compensation rules in light of its own circumstances. you hereby confirm the reasonableness, fairness and objectivity of the foregoing compensation rules, and fully accepts and acknowledges the same.
